Chief among those who wanted to provide economic support for the freedmen after the Civil War was: Group of answer choices Abraham Lincoln. U.S. Grant. Andrew Johnson. Thaddeus Stevens.

Answers

The correct answer is (C) Thaddeus Stevens.

Who was Thaddeus Stevens.

From Pennsylvania, Thaddeus Stevens served in the US House of Representatives.

Thaddeus Stevens was a key figure in the Republican Party's Radical Republican movement in the 1860s.

Stevens, a fervent opponent of slavery and prejudice against black Americans, spearheaded the resistance to American President Andrew Johnson during Reconstruction in an effort to guarantee their rights.

Thaddeus Stevens played a key role as the chairman of the House Ways and Means Committee during the American Civil War, concentrating on the defeat of the Confederacy, raising money through new taxes and borrowing, destroying the influence of slave owners, putting an end to slavery, and securing equal rights for freedmen.

The reason that angered American colonists regarding the 1686 Dominion of New England was C) It invalidated the Massachusetts Bay colony's original land titles.

The Dominion of New England was a British colonial administrative union created in 1686 by combining several colonies, including Massachusetts, Plymouth, Connecticut, New Hampshire, and Rhode Island, under a single government. This consolidation of power and authority by the British Crown resulted in several actions that angered the American colonists.

One of the key grievances was the invalidation of the Massachusetts Bay colony's original land titles. The Dominion of New England sought to centralize control over land and property rights, leading to the cancellation of existing land grants and titles that had been established by the Massachusetts Bay colony. This action threatened the colonists' ownership and control over their lands, undermining their economic and social stability.

The American colonists had a strong attachment to their land and property rights, which they considered essential to their economic prosperity and independence. The invalidation of land titles disrupted established landownership patterns and created uncertainty and dissatisfaction among the colonists.

In summary, the 1686 Dominion of New England angered American colonists due to the invalidation of the Massachusetts Bay colony's original land titles, which threatened their ownership and control over their lands.

after the russo-turkish war, the treaty of berlin placed what balkan states under austria-hungarian rule?

Answers

After the Russo-Turkish War, the Treaty of Berlin placed Bosnia and Herzegovina under Austria-Hungarian rule.

The treaty was signed on July 13, 1878, and it revised the earlier Treaty of San Stefano which had ended the war. The Treaty of Berlin was an effort to prevent the growth of Russian influence in the Balkans and to maintain the balance of power in Europe.

As a result, Bosnia and Herzegovina were placed under the administration of Austria-Hungary, although they technically remained part of the Ottoman Empire. This arrangement lasted until 1908, when Austria-Hungary formally annexed Bosnia and Herzegovina.
